Mobs in Algeria

(February 7, 2014)

These Arabs in Algeria are destroying a village where the Mazigh live. The Mazigh are an ethnic minority:


This was a short clip that the BBC Arabic ran throughout the day, but I don't think they had a lot of information. They didn't do in-depth analysis. Maybe they had been unable to get a hold of anyone. They did show part of a video that a Mazigh man appeared to have made. He was saying that the Mazigh are Algerian citizens, but it looks like some Arab Algerians are unhappy about that.

In addition to destroying the village, they destroyed World Heritage Sites, as named by Unesco, which were located in the village.

And the segment also mentioned that while all this destruction was going on, the police forces were just watching. I think one man interviewed said something like, we were looking to the police for help, but the police was just staring.
